A device for facilitating the formation of new bone tissue, the device comprising: a body that defines an upper portion and a lower portion, said lower portion having a substantially frustum shape, said upper portion having a substantially cylindrical shape, said lower portion being adapted to be inserted into a medullary canal of a bone, wherein said body is an internally hollow body which has a top opening and a bottom opening, said device being provided by an additive powder technology, wherein said lower portion and said upper portion of the body have a porous outer surface configured to facilitate osseointegration, wherein said upper portion is internally contoured in steps toward an axis of the body, so as to define, from the upper portion toward the lower portion, a first step which connects a first inner upper portion to a second inner upper portion, by way of an inner curved portion, said first step defined by the inner curved portion protruding inside the hollow body with a convex portion, and a second step which connects the second inner upper portion to an inner surface of the lower portion, said second step being also defined by an inner curved portion protruding inside the hollow body with a convex portion, and wherein said upper portion is blended with said lower portion with a curved concave segment.
